ZIP Code 77389 is a ZIP Code Tabulation Area in Harris County, Texas, home to about 44,545 residents. The median household income of $145,228 is above the Harris County median ($73,104).
Between 2019 and 2023, ZIP Code 77389's population grew 16.5% from 38,222 to 44,545, while its median gross rent rose 10.3% from $1,628 to $1,795.
The typical home was built around 2010. 8.6% of residents live below the poverty line.

| Year | Population | Median household income | Median home value | Median gross rent |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 38,222 | $126,473 | $320,000 | $1,628 |
| 2020 | 39,907 | $124,315 | $310,300 | $1,694 |
| 2021 | 41,982 | $133,418 | $325,200 | $1,723 |
| 2022 | 43,674 | $142,611 | $377,900 | $1,699 |
| 2023 | 44,545 | $145,228 | $387,100 | $1,795 |
Each year is a US Census Bureau ACS 5-year estimate ending that year.
